Transaction 8596b2f8f61a2cb9c21dd34fa2426b26e7e83a456bf909d21cd106a8e6202586
1 Input
1 Output
-
8596b2f8f61a2cb9c21dd34fa2426b26e7e83a456bf909d21cd106a8e6202586:0
- value
- 26582
- script pubkey
- OP_0 OP_PUSHBYTES_20 a0258263d389e43627e2e198b779385a26b9e1b1
- address
- bc1q5qjcyc7n38jrvflzuxvtw7fctgntncd3v78ecd